GORDON: How long will this take? JAMIESON: Eight months, nine months. We’re going to try to do everyone. We want to do everyone.
Will readers still be interested come next March? I think these pages are going to grow in impact. We’ll start getting back to our lives, and these faces will still be appearing in the paper every day.
Is this a coveted assignment or a dreaded one? Both. It’s a lot of work for a small story and no byline. But I think the reporters are surprised to find it as hugely fulfilling as it is. I have seen reporters crying on the phone with people. I’ve also seen them laughing. There’s so much death in the paper now, but you’re writing about people’s lives.
